Edward Charles "Ed" Sharockman (born November 4, 1939 in St. Clair, Pennsylvania) is a former professional American football defensive back.
Sharockman graduated from the University of Pittsburgh, where he starred as a cornerback. He played 11 seasons in the National Football League, all with the Minnesota Vikings (1961–1972). He started in Super Bowl IV.
